Thomas Boivin is a scholar working on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, Insect Science and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as Boivin has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 770 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, 20 papers in Insect Science and 17 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Thomas Boivin’s work include Plant and animal studies (21 papers), Forest Insect Ecology and Management (9 papers) and Insect-Plant Interactions and Control (9 papers). Thomas Boivin is often cited by papers focused on Plant and animal studies (21 papers), Forest Insect Ecology and Management (9 papers) and Insect-Plant Interactions and Control (9 papers). Thomas Boivin collaborates with scholars based in France, Morocco and Canada. Thomas Boivin's co-authors include Benoît Sauphanor, Dominique Beslay, Jean‐Charles Bouvier, Claire Lavigne and Jean‐Noël Candau and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and Molecular Ecology.
